    Underwater photography is the process of taking photographs while under water. It is usually done while scuba diving , but can be done while diving on surface supply , snorkeling , swimming , from a submersible or remotely operated underwater vehicle , or from automated cameras lowered from the surface.

    Emoto claimed that water was a "blueprint for our reality" and that emotional "energies" and "vibrations" could change its physical structure. [14] His water crystal experiments consisted of exposing water in glasses to various words, pictures, or music, then freezing it and examining the ice crystals' aesthetic properties with microscopic photography. The history of photography began with the discovery of two critical principles: The first is camera obscura image projection, the second is the discovery that some substances are visibly altered by exposure to light.
